Varietal creation for organic vegetable species

This was the theme of the October 6th and 7th meeting for the Vegetable Section from the French Breeders’ Association.

The afternoon of October 6th was an opportunity to tack stock of the regulatory evolutions resulting from the RUE 2018/848 regulation, to discuss in front of DUS trials of population varieties at the GEVES station in Brion and then to discover the production and selection activities of an organic seed producer.

On the morning of October 7th, at the Agro Angers Institute, presentations by breeders and prescribers involved in organic agriculture illustrated the specific needs of organic seeds and the state of research to respond to them.
